Output 18c7951cf3b2ce30aee6eaea6598a9a4a740e5d2cddaf0c419b2439ecbab9f59:1

value
15284947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720d5634b0c28c882c5870178463e1731c074e3c OP_EQUAL
address
3C64w4kUqVkZ9ThAA7fWaFkf4S5Ts2FqnK
transaction
18c7951cf3b2ce30aee6eaea6598a9a4a740e5d2cddaf0c419b2439ecbab9f59
spent
true